Nashville police find trans school shooter's suicide note—refuse to release details
 
The Metropolitan Nashville Police Department reportedly found a suicide note left by trans-identifying school shooter Audrey Hale during their search of the now deceased assailant's home.
 
While authorities have confirmed that the note exists, its contents have not disclosed what it contains.
 
According to NBC News, on Tuesday authorities released a list of items discovered at the home following the shooting. Among them were several journals, a shotgun, cellphones, laptops, and a suicide note. Old photos and yearbooks from The Covenant School, where Hale was a former student, were also recovered.
 
The MNPD declined to provide further details regarding the contents of the note, a document which many have suggested could shine some light on the potential motive behind the mass shooting, which left six people dead.
 
Officers did reveal, however, that many of the othe documents they found included notes about firearms courses and school shootings of the past. 
 
On Monday, police revealed that Hale planned the attack "over a period of months," and that she fired 152 rounds from the time she shot her way into the school until being killed by police.
 
"The writings remain under careful review by the MNPD and the FBI's Behavioral Analysis Unit based in Quantico, Virginia. The motive for Hale’s actions has not been established and remains under investigation by the Homicide Unit in consultation with the FBI’s Behavioral Analysis Unit," MNPD wrote.
 
Hale's manifesto has also been recovered, and its contents will reportedly be released to the public as soon as the FBI has analyzed it.

Another Biden Administration COVID-19 Vaccine Mandate Struck Down by Court
 
President Joe Biden’s administration did not have the authority to impose a COVID-19 vaccine mandate on workers and volunteers in a federal childcare program, a U.S. judge has ruled.
 
The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) forced Head Start workers, and some volunteers, to get a COVID-19 vaccine starting in early 2022. Head Start provides childcare to children from low-income families.
 
HHS cited the Head Start Act, which says the health secretary can add “administrative and financial management standards,” “standards relating to the condition and location of facilities (including indoor air quality assessment standards, where appropriate),” and “such other standards as the secretary finds to be appropriate.”
 
Texas Attorney General Ken Paxton argued that the mandate was outside of the power granted by the act. The law “does not mention vaccinations,” he and other plaintiffs said in a brief.
 
U.S. District Judge James Wesley Hendrix agreed.
 
“The wisdom of Head Start’s rule is not before the Court—only its legality. If the people, through Congress, wish to impose a vaccine mandate on Head Start programs, they may do so by passing a law. But an agency can do only what Congress authorizes it to do,” Hendrix, a Trump appointee, said in his ruling.
